Lesson Ideas by Category

Ready-to-adapt lessons that put SmartEssay.ai and Smart-Reader.ai to work in your classroom.

Responsible AI policies· SmartEssay.ai

Co-write a class AI-use charter: students draft what responsible AI help looks like for their own writing, then revise it together using SmartEssay.ai's coaching prompts.

Teaching writing with AI· SmartEssay.ai

Two-draft revision cycle: students submit a first draft cold, then run a second draft in SmartEssay.ai focusing on one skill (evidence, transitions, or voice) and reflect on what changed.

Reading comprehension· Smart-Reader.ai

Chunked close-reading of a challenging article in Smart-Reader.ai: students summarize each section in their own words and predict the author's next move before revealing it.

Critical thinking· Smart-Reader.ai

Claim-and-evidence sort: load an opinion piece into Smart-Reader.ai and have students separate claims from support, then rank the strongest and weakest evidence.

Assessment ideas· SmartEssay.ai

Process-based grading: students submit their SmartEssay.ai coaching history alongside the final draft so you can assess revision moves, not just the finished product.

Digital citizenship· Smart-Reader.ai

Source triangulation lesson: give students three articles on the same event in Smart-Reader.ai and have them compare framing, sourcing, and reliability.

Ethical AI use· SmartEssay.ai

"My words vs. AI words" reflection: after a SmartEssay.ai session, students highlight what they wrote themselves and explain how the coaching shaped — but didn't replace — their thinking.

Vocabulary & language· Smart-Reader.ai

Context-clue hunt in Smart-Reader.ai: students identify unfamiliar words in a passage, predict meaning from context, then verify and use each word in an original sentence.
